Georgia basketball vs. Gonzaga final odds
Georgia enters the first round of the NCAA Tournament against Gonzaga as a 6.5 point underdog, according to FanDuel Sportsbook. The over-under for this game is set at 138.5 point as well. ESPN's Matchup Predictor also favors Gonzaga as they only give Georgia a 28.6 percent chance to win this game.
Georgia basketball vs. Gonzaga prediction
While the 8-seed vs. 9-seed matchup is routinely one of the better first round matchups on paper, that doesn't seem like the case in Georgia's game. While UGA and their fans are very confident they can come away with a win against Gonzaga, the rest of the public isn't giving Georgia much of a chance at all.
Maybe that's because Georgia hasn't been to the tournament since 2015 while Gonzaga has made the Sweet 16 nine years in a row. Or maybe it's because Gonzaga is ranked inside the top 10 of the NET rankings even though they are an 8-seed. Regardless, not many people are giving Georgia a chance.
This could play right into Georgia's hand as that extra motivation they need to win this game. However, their inexperience might just be the downfall for this team this season.
This game will not be a blowout like some experts think, but it is a little difficult imagining a world where the Bulldogs are able to beat this Gonzaga team who have proven year in and year out to be elite in this tournament.
Prediction: Gonzaga wins 77-73
